The Himachal Pradesh government is developing master plans to upgrade and beautify Kangra district temples, starting with Jwalamukhi. NIT-Hamirpur is designing the Jwalamukhi plan. The project aims to improve infrastructure, enhance amenities, boost religious tourism, and modernize temple management through digital services while maintaining traditions.
An oxygen plant sanctioned in 2020 for Thural Civil Hospital remains non-operational due to bureaucratic delays. Despite PMO instructions, installation stalled for four years. Lack of space, infrastructure, and halted building construction hampered progress. A newly appointed CMO will investigate the delay.
